In Germany there are several dealers who import the Mustang.

Ford does not have the Mustang officially in its program. A big mistake, IMO.

I plan to get a GT in April 2006.

Right now the price for a GT without options is at 36950 Euros, that's appr. 46200 USD.

A 2 year warranty is included. This price is the actual sum one has to pay, it includes all applicable taxes.

$41K after all taxes. the price of my car on X-plan was about $33,000CDN, which as about $1500 less than sticker price. add to that warranty($900 on xplan), all the taxes and all that crap dealerships charge (freight tax, gas tax, etc.) and the bottomline was $41,000CDN
